How much does it cost to rent a home in Atlanta?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Atlanta 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,244 | $570 | $8,500 |
| Atlanta 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,528 | $660 | $10,000+ |
| Atlanta 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,172 | $570 | $10,000+ |
| Atlanta 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,926 | $1,000 | $10,000+ |
| Atlanta 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$8,787 | $900 | $10,000+ |
| Atlanta 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$12,974 | $2,245 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Atlanta
What type of rentals are currently available in Atlanta?
There are currently 3557 Apartments for Rent in Atlanta, GA with pricing that ranges from $200 to $23,202. There are also 2935 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Atlanta ranging from $385 to $35,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Atlanta?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Atlanta ranges from $385 to $35,000 with an average monthly rent of $5,612.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Atlanta?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Atlanta range from $830 to $19,085,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$660 to $18,500.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$570 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$795.
